Today arrive at Kochi, meet and greet at the airport and transfer to the hotel.
Kochi is the only place in the country where you can see St. Francis church, Jewish synagogue, Hindu temples, Dutch palace & Mosque nearly side by side. This evening enjoy a boat Trip along the palm fringed lakes & backwaters of the area. As you will sail along the shady canals, you will see cantilevered Chinese fishing nets. Later attend the performance of the Kathakali, one of India’s most famous classical dance. Lavish costumes & exotic makeup & masks intensify the beauty of the dancers, intricate moments. Overnight stay.
After breakfast depart to Thrissur, considered as the cultural capital of Kerala with its art schools, cultural institutions and many festivals. Visit this city, Vadakkunnathan, Thiruvambadi and Paramekkavu, cathedral of Our Lady of Lourdes and churches Puthanpalli and Chaldean. The town is a home to a community of Nestorian Christians whose origin dates back to the 3rd century. Visit the beautiful archaeological museum with its magnificent models of temples and stone bas-reliefs. Continue to Athirappilly, located in the tropical forest and surrounded by impressive waterfalls, this site is surrounded by beautiful landscapes. Overnight stay.
After breakfast drive to Munnar. Upon arrival check into the hotel. Munnar is situated at the confluence of three mountains streams – Mudrapuzha, Nallathanni & Kundala. Later visit Mattupetty – 13 kms away from Munnar, situated at a height of 1700m. It is famous for its highly specialized dairy farm – the indo Swiss livestock project. Over a hundred varieties of high yielding cattles are reared here. Visit Mattupetty lake & dam just a short distance from the farm, is a very beautiful picnic spot. Overnight stay.
Discover the sprawling Kundala tea plantations and the Kundala Lake in the vicinity, the most beautiful tea plantations of the country surrounded by rocky peaks whose highest point is 2695 meters. This exceptional setting is unique in south India. Stroll in Eravikulam national park and towards "Top station" which offers sublime views on the plains of Tamil Nadu. Overnight stay.
After breakfast depart by road for Kodaikanal, located at 2100 meters, on the peaks of the Palani mountains. It is surrounded by blue eucalyptus plantations. Visit the museum of Fauna and Flora in sacred Heart college, in Shenbaganur. Visit the Silver Cascade falls. There are many walks to do and many waterfalls to discover. This is a must for mountain lovers. Overnight stay.
After breakfast drive to Madurai - it is a colourful city. The main city area revolves around Meenakshi temple, with its baroque example of Dravidian architecture & the four tall Gopuram (Pillars) with multi-coloured gods, goddess, demons & deities. Madurai is surrounded by coconut grooves & rice paddies. Overnight stay.
In the morning, depart for the visit of Mariamman Teppakulam located at 5 km of Madurai. In January and February takes place the festival of Teppam: the pilgrims flock by thousands from the whole India. Visit the temple of Alagarkovil located in the countryside at the foot of the hills, 20 km from Madurai. Return to Madurai and continue with the discovery of the city. Also visit the markets and other temples.
In the afternoon visit to Meenakshi temple where Dravidian temple architecture may be seen in its exuberant baroque phase. Its hall of thousand pillars is fabulous & is filled with worshippers at all hours of the day. Also visit the Tirumal Nayak's palace founded in 1636, which is in a highly decorative monument. Overnight stay.
After breakfast drive to a tranquil hill retreat, the spicy village. Along the way we pass through tea, cinnamon, clove & cardamom plantations –beautiful to see & smell.This evening we visit the nearby Periyar Game sanctuary; Game viewing here is like no other safari experience. We simply relax in a Motor launch & sail. During the dry season tigers & panthers come down to the lake shore for drinking water – be sure to have plenty of film on hand. Overnight stay.
After breakfast drive to Kumarakom in the heart of backwater. Discover the temple Ettumanoor renowned for its superb carved wood and wall paintings. Enjoy a sunset cruise every evening on a vallam (country boat) out on the open backwaters. The sights, breezes, sounds and smells of the late evenings are indeed very soothing. If you are lucky you might also catch the moonrise. Visit St. Mary’s church at Vechoor. This is an old syrian Catholic church with a history dating back to over 500 years. It is a great place to exchange travelers’ tales. Overnight stay.
After breakfast board the backwaters cruise Kettuvalam - An Authentic Kerala Houseboat - the moving master piece, have been plying the inland waterways of southwest India for untold centuries and originally used as cargo rice boats. The fully furnished and palm covered boats (single & double) bedrooms with attached bath, sit out, kitchen and living room made of traditional wood. Punters stand on each end of the boat for punting and directing the boat. Kerosene-lit lamps along will be available for light and mosquito nets will be provided. Traditional vegetarian and non-vegetarian Kerala cuisines are served. You will see lush palm groves and stretches of rice fields. Overnight stay at the houseboat.
After breakfast drive to Marari, en route visit Rani John's house to discover the project for the preservation of the historical heritage of Alapuzzha. Walk in the spice market, visit Jain temple and an Anglican church, testimony to the great openness and tolerance of Kerala with regard to religions. Visit to a a former British factory where traditional methods of weaving coir fibre are still being applied. Drive continues to Marari. Overnight stay.
